
Tracy Donley brings over 16 years of experience in healthcare, with a strong focus on business development and outreach. Inspired by her mother’s career as a healthcare administrator, Tracy began her professional journey in long-term care and senior living before moving into the addiction and behavioral health space—where she found her true calling.
Her passion for helping people began with a pivotal moment early in her career, when she learned that women waiting outside a healthcare facility were victims of human trafficking. Determined to help, Tracy partnered with a local prosecutor, wrote a grant that provided those women with access to private treatment, and became a licensed interventionist.
Since then, Tracy has worked with crisis intervention teams, healthcare unions, law enforcement, and addiction treatment programs across the Midwest. She’s known for her hands-on, compassionate approach—whether she’s helping nurses and doctors find support, working with union representatives, or walking the streets to reach individuals in need. Tracy takes pride in meeting people where they are and guiding them into treatment with empathy and care.
She is especially passionate about supporting healthcare professionals and their families, and she is well-known for her work with organizations like General Motors and Ford unions. Her deep understanding of both the healthcare and addiction landscapes allows her to build trusted relationships and create meaningful pathways to care.
